    Best Thai food I have found in KC- vegan or not!! We have ordered from here multiple times now- the gyoza is bomb. Thumbs up on the pineapple fried rice, the pad Thai and the drunken noodles. The Tom Ka soup is SO good! We get the papaya salad every time and it's got the perfect amount of kick. It's a "ghost kitchen" so the only option is delivery which is super cool. This restaurant is highly recommended!

    As someone who lives in St. Louis and visits Kansas City several times per year, I always make it…read moremy mission to stop by Cafe Gratitude for a meal while I'm in town! I tried Cafe Gratitude for the first time a few years ago, and I haven't stopped thinking about this place since. They provide more than just food... it's a whole EXPERIENCE. I've always been very warmly greeted at the front entrance. Sometimes while visiting, I've had a short wait. Other times are more empty, such as when there's a Chiefs game. All of the employees are extremely kind, personable, and welcoming. Service has truly never lacked for me here. You will notice right away that every menu item is an affirmation. At the top of the menu, it says, "I Am..." and each drink, appetizer, and entree is a positive word. As your food is delivered, they tell you your affirmation. For example, if I ordered the Warm Hearted bowl, they would say, "You are Warm Hearted." Even the water pitchers at each table have affirmative words on them. It's the little things like this that make Cafe Gratitude so special! Also, as you're placing your order, your server will leave your table with a "question of the day" that you can reflect upon and discuss with others. My partner and I love these prompts while we're waiting on our food. There's also a deck of special cards at each table that have additional questions for reflection! I try to order a different menu item every time I visit, so I've enjoyed a little bit of everything at this point. For appetizers, you have to try the Plentiful (chili). While I've never had anything here that I didn't love, my top favorite entrees would have to be Terrific (raw pad thai bowl), Warm Hearted (Italian polenta and squash noodles), and Whole (macrobiotic bowl). I also love Grateful, also known as their community bowl. If you need financial assistance with this bowl, you may pay a sliding scale of $3-11. If you want to contribute to someone else, you can pick an amount and set it aside for someone in need. I wish more businesses did this! During my most recent visit, I decided to try Transformed (tacos), which include sweet potatoes, black beans, guacamole-style hummus, pico de gallo, and cashew nacho cheese on organic corn tacos. They were delicious, but I'll probably stick to my bowls next time! It came with a side salad that wasn't anything super special but still full of flavor. The walls of the restaurant are covered in local art that rotates regularly and is available for purchase. The space itself is very cute and cozy. I read more about Cafe Gratitude's story on their website, and much of the interior is upcycled. For example, many of the light fixtures are made of old wine and vodka bottles. At the host stand, they have Cafe Gratitude postcards that you can write a message on, and they'll mail them out for you. The flavors of everything here is unmatched. Such unique combinations that my heart so happy. I always leave here feeling so fulfilled.
